I'm not sure what you mean by "quit working". Do the buttons disappear or just do nothing when you click them? Have you run traceSM with both SIP and PPM tracing enabled? Do both application sequences have the same CM in them? Generally a system has only one sequence unless you have multiple CMs and are running in half-call mode (i.e. feature server vs evolution server).

I am in the process of moving agents off 1-x agent to Workplace for Agents. My agents are built as J179CC, but I am having an issue with the app sequence in their profile. The ACD buttons only work when the app sequence in the profile is built as cm-app-seq. If you set the sequence app to CM5061 the ACD buttons quit working. We are trying to standardize the app sequence and only have 1 app sequence for a user profile. Normal SIP workplace users work fine with the CM5061 app sequence. Does anyone know if there is a fix for this or will we be required to run both app sequences for Workplace.
